Output 8657388ecf4bf3574749cb4ef793a3c9b89a689fdd27cdab07536cd46f739647:57

value
71601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d993d53a09abd0568b9b0cc179000287d3bd4b3 OP_EQUAL
address
3MtiqD6beLMoXkBfYB41dUhUuQG6wXoRsV
transaction
8657388ecf4bf3574749cb4ef793a3c9b89a689fdd27cdab07536cd46f739647